1 // S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-or-later 2 /* 3 * USB Network driver infrastructure 4 * Copyright (C) 2000-2005 by David Brownell 5 * Copyright (C) 2003-2005 David Hollis <dhollis@davehollis.com> 6 */ 7 8 /* 9 * This is a generic "USB networking" framework that works with several 10 * kinds of full and high speed networking devices: host-to-host cables, 11 * smart usb peripherals, and actual Ethernet adapters. 12 * 13 * These devices usually differ in terms of control protocols (if they 14 * even have one!) and sometimes they define new framing to wrap or batch 15 * Ethernet packets. Otherwise, they talk to USB pretty much the same, 16 * so interface (un)binding, endpoint I/O queues, fault handling, and other 17 * issues can usefully be addressed by this framework. 18 */ 19 20 #include <linux/module.h> 21 #include <linux/init.h> 22 #include <linux/netdevice.h> 23 #include <linux/etherdevice.h> 24 #include <linux/ctype.h> 25 #include <linux/ethtool.h> 26 #include <linux/workqueue.h> 27 #include <linux/mii.h> 28 #include <linux/usb.h> 29 #include <linux/usb/usbnet.h> 30 #include <linux/slab.h> 31 #include <linux/kernel.h> 32 #include <linux/pm_runtime.h> 33 34 /*-------------------------------------------------------------------------*/ 35 36 /* 37 * Nineteen USB 1.1 max size bulk transactions per frame (ms), max. 38 * Several dozen bytes of IPv4 data can fit in two such transactions. 39 * One maximum size Ethernet packet takes twenty four of them. 40 * For high speed, each frame comfortably fits almost 36 max size 41 * Ethernet packets (so queues should be bigger). 42 * 43 * The goal is to let the USB host controller be busy for 5msec or 44 * more before an irq is required, under load. Jumbograms change 45 * the equation. 46 */ 47 #define MAX_QUEUE_MEMORY (60 * 1518) 48 #define RX_QLEN(dev) ((dev)->rx_qlen) 49 #define TX_QLEN(dev) ((dev)->tx_qlen) 50 51 // reawaken network queue this soon after stopping; else watchdog barks 52 #define TX_TIMEOUT_JIFFIES (5*HZ) 53 54 /* throttle rx/tx briefly after some faults, so hub_wq might disconnect() 55 * us (it polls at HZ/4 usually) before we report too many false errors. 56 */ 57 #define THROTTLE_JIFFIES (HZ/8) 58 59 // between wakeups 60 #define UNLINK_TIMEOUT_MS 3 61 62 /*-------------------------------------------------------------------------*/ 63 64 /* use ethtool to change the level for any given device */ 65 static int msg_level = -1; 66 module_param (msg_level, int, 0); 67 MODULE_PARM_DESC (msg_level, "Override default message level"); 68 69 /*-------------------------------------------------------------------------*/ 70 71 static const char * const usbnet_event_names[] = { 72 [EVENT_TX_HALT] = "EVENT_TX_HALT", 73 [EVENT_RX_HALT] = "EVENT_RX_HALT", 74 [EVENT_RX_MEMORY] = "EVENT_RX_MEMORY", 75 [EVENT_STS_SPLIT] = "EVENT_STS_SPLIT", 76 [EVENT_LINK_RESET] = "EVENT_LINK_RESET", 77 [EVENT_RX_PAUSED] = "EVENT_RX_PAUSED", 78 [EVENT_DEV_ASLEEP] = "EVENT_DEV_ASLEEP", 79 [EVENT_DEV_OPEN] = "EVENT_DEV_OPEN", 80 [EVENT_DEVICE_REPORT_IDLE] = "EVENT_DEVICE_REPORT_IDLE", 81 [EVENT_NO_RUNTIME_PM] = "EVENT_NO_RUNTIME_PM", 82 [EVENT_RX_KILL] = "EVENT_RX_KILL", 83 [EVENT_LINK_CHANGE] = "EVENT_LINK_CHANGE", 84 [EVENT_SET_RX_MODE] = "EVENT_SET_RX_MODE", 85 [EVENT_NO_IP_ALIGN] = "EVENT_NO_IP_ALIGN", 86 }; 87 88 /* handles CDC Ethernet and many other network "bulk data" interfaces */ 89 int usbnet_get_endpoints(struct usbnet *dev, struct usb_interface *intf) 90 { 91 int tmp; 92 struct usb_host_interface *alt = NULL; 93 struct usb_host_endpoint *in = NULL, *out = NULL; 94 struct usb_host_endpoint *status = NULL; 95 96 for (tmp = 0; tmp < intf->num_altsetting; tmp++) { 97 unsigned ep; 98 99 in = out = status = NULL; 100 alt = intf->altsetting + tmp; 101 102 /* take the first altsetting with in-bulk + out-bulk; 103 * remember any status endpoint, just in case; 104 * ignore other endpoints and altsettings. 105 */ 106 for (ep = 0; ep < alt->desc.bNumEndpoints; ep++) { 107 struct usb_host_endpoint *e; 108 int intr = 0; 109 110 e = alt->endpoint + ep; 111 112 /* ignore endpoints which cannot transfer data */ 113 if (!usb_endpoint_maxp(&e->desc)) 114 continue; 115 116 switch (e->desc.bmAttributes) { 117 case USB_ENDPOINT_XFER_INT: 118 if (!usb_endpoint_dir_in(&e->desc)) 119 continue; 120 intr = 1; 121 fallthrough; 122 case USB_ENDPOINT_XFER_BULK: 123 break; 124 default: 125 continue; 126 } 127 if (usb_endpoint_dir_in(&e->desc)) { 128 if (!intr && !in) 129 in = e; 130 else if (intr && !status) 131 status = e; 132 } else { 133 if (!out) 134 out = e; 135 } 136 } 137 if (in && out) 138 break; 139 } 140 if (!alt || !in || !out) 141 return -EINVAL; 142 143 if (alt->desc.bAlternateSetting != 0 || 144 !(dev->driver_info->flags & FLAG_NO_SETINT)) { 145 tmp = usb_set_interface(dev->udev, alt->desc.bInterfaceNumber, 146 alt->desc.bAlternateSetting); 147 if (tmp < 0) 148 return tmp; 149 } 150 151 dev->in = usb_rcvbulkpipe(dev->udev, 152 in->desc.bEndpointAddress & USB_ENDPOINT_NUMBER_MASK); 153 dev->out = usb_sndbulkpipe(dev->udev, 154 out->desc.bEndpointAddress & USB_ENDPOINT_NUMBER_MASK); 155 dev->status = status; 156 return 0; 157 } 158 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(usbnet_get_endpoints); 159 160 int usbnet_get_ethernet_addr(struct usbnet *dev, int iMACAddress) 161 { 162 u8 addr[ETH_ALEN]; 163 int tmp = -1, ret; 164 unsigned char buf [13]; 165 166 ret = usb_string(dev->udev, iMACAddress, buf, sizeof(buf)); 167 if (ret == 12) 168 tmp = hex2bin(addr, buf, 6); 169 if (tmp < 0) { 170 dev_dbg(&dev->udev->dev, 171 "bad MAC string %d fetch, %d\n", iMACAddress, tmp); 172 if (ret >= 0) 173 ret = -EINVAL; 174 return ret; 175 } 176 eth_hw_addr_set(dev->net, addr); 177 return 0; 178 } 179 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(usbnet_get_ethernet_addr); 180 181 static bool usbnet_needs_usb_name_format(struct usbnet *dev, struct net_device *net) 182 { 183 /* Point to point devices which don't have a real MAC address 184 * (or report a fake local one) have historically used the usb%d 185 * naming.
